    I was given "Robert L Chapman's Ireland, photographs from the Chapman Collection 1907-1957 last Christmas.

    Chapman-small.jpg"The Chapman Collection is a unique collection of photographs spanning the half-century from 1907 to 1957 that offers a glimpse of a bygone age in Ireland. These remarkable photographs, complemented by his journal and diary entries – at turns descriptive and witty – are drawn from an archive of around 3,000 pictures"

    Apart from the Boards.ie Yearbook, which has a great variety of work, I can also reccomend Bill Doyle's Ireland. It's available from the Gallery of Photography and is a very nice retrospective of Bill's work.
